Add logic to conditionally hide non-essential tabs in pinned tab management

This commit is contained in:
mr. M
2025-02-23 22:11:58 +01:00
parent 12891ab238
commit 60e2cab249
2 changed files with 18 additions and 1 deletions

View File

@@ -290,8 +290,10 @@
}
}
gBrowser.tabContainer._invalidateCachedTabs();
newTab.initialize();
if (!ZenWorkspaces.essentialShouldShowTab(newTab)) {
gBrowser.hideTab(newTab, undefined, true);
}
}
gBrowser._updateTabBarForPinnedTabs();